The blood-gas status of seven sheep with experimentally induced heartwater during the acute and terminal
stages was investigated. Changes in blood gas included a decline in arterial oxygen tension (pO₂)
combined with a respiratory alkalosis. Although the sheep became hypoxaemic, blood-gas changes
associated with respiratory failure were not observed. |
